Law Of Large Numbers In Simulations
Two students perform simulations to estimate the probability of a complex event. Student A performs 100 trials and gets an estimate of 0.43. Student B performs 10,000 trials and gets an estimate of 0.412. The true probability is unknown. Which statement is most justified?
A
Both estimates are equally reliable
B
Student A’s estimate is more efficient and equally reliable
C
Student B’s estimate is likely closer to the true probability
D
The true probability is exactly 0.412
